The kingston 4 GB is just another regular flash drive, from features to design, nothing stands out. It is not bad, and the price is great, but if u r looking for something more exciting and with faster writing speed, I won't recommend this one.

You can always fing Kingston on sale somewhere.  Its not expensive and has 4gb on a thumbdrive.  Why shell out for some fancy titanium thumbdrive when memory haves in price every year. 4 gigs on your keychain should keep you happy for a few years, and if it stops working for some reason eventually, memory will be a lot cheaper then anyway.
